When is a TV show cancelled? SciFi/Fantasy fans will be familiar with US networks killing off shows without a second thought. Recent deaths of Almost Human and Revolution cutting particularly deep. So whats going on with Dracula. The Dracula TV series is new to Dubai on OSN, so apologies for coming Kate to the party. TV continues to use the Victorian period age timely. Just think Deadwood, Sanctuary and Hell on Wheels for the US. Carnival Films Dracula is Jonathan Rhys Meyer baby, and a nice offspring it has become. Full of UK acting talent giving it a gloss that prime period Hammer would have loved. Nicely incorporating Jules Verne and SciFi Victorian Steam Punk ( think of the recent film version of The Three Musketeers) meets Coppola sumptuous Dracula, with flavours of Annie Rice (and touches of Angel and Vampire Dairies when they went all Victorian) plus an element of Ripper Street (possibly newcomer Penny Dreadful also .. But I have not seen that yet). This is an imaginative reimagining (!) of a tired old story full of familiar tropes and deserves to succeed. However has it been cancelled? NBC seem to have dropped out but Rhys Meyer claims a second series is being made. More on this when I understand!! en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dracula_(TV_series)
